AISC-1210HF-4R7JS Overview

General Purpose Inductor, 4.7uH, 5%, 1 Element, Ceramic-ferrite-Core, SMD

AISC-1210HF-4R7JS Parametric

Parameter NameAttribute value
Reach Compliance Codeunknown
ECCN codeEAR99
core materialCERAMIC-FERRITE
DC Resistance1.2 Ω
Nominal inductance(L)4.7 µH
Inductor ApplicationsPOWER INDUCTOR
Inductor typeGENERAL PURPOSE INDUCTOR
JESD-609 codee0
Number of functions1
Number of terminals2
Maximum operating temperature125 °C
Minimum operating temperature-40 °C
Minimum quality factor (at nominal inductance)20
self resonant frequency32 MHz
Shape/Size DescriptionRECTANGULAR PACKAGE
shieldNO
surface mountYES
Terminal surfaceTIN LEAD
Terminal locationDUAL ENDED
Terminal shapeWRAPAROUND
Test frequency1 MHz
Tolerance5%
Base Number Matches1
SURFACE MOUNT UNSHIELDED POWER INDUCTORS
AISC - 1210H
| | | | | | | | | | | | | | |
FEATURES:
• Construction: Ceramic or Ferrite
• Excellent SRF
• High Frequency Design
• Excellent Q values
OPTIONS:
• Tape & Reel is standard
• Add L for no Cap, F for Ferrite Base
• Add G for Gold Plated Terminal
• Add S for Solder Plated Terminal
APPLICATIONS:
• Wireless Communications Equipment
• Networking System
• Computer Products and Peripherals
